putte64 commented on 2024-02-10 14:41 (UTC)

@matj1 Thank you for your feedback. Your AUR-helper should now download the latest version of PKGBUILD (as you found out and did by yourself). The PKGBUILD will then always get the latest git version available, even if it looks like its not updated. But it will not warn you of new versions available unfortunately. (As far as I know, that's the nature of GIT repos)

putte64 commented on 2022-10-12 14:07 (UTC) (edited on 2022-12-29 22:13 (UTC) by putte64)

There's a important and easy bug to be fixed in the PKGBUILD script.

In line 54: tdestdir="$pkgdir/usr/share/$pkgname/i18n"

$pkgname is pointing to "openlp-git", but for translations to work, it must be replaced with "openlp". (not $pkgname ofcourse, but the path)

Edit: This should be fixed now
